构建跨多站点的分布式存储架构需要考虑哪些技术细节?

参与9

2同行回答

宁泽阳宁泽阳系统工程师某科技公司
构建跨多站点的分布式存储集群时建议考虑: 各站点之间是否部署同1个集群,如果为同1个集群需重点关注网络带宽和时延是否可满足集群需要;如果为不同集群,需考虑数据同步方式(同步复制或异步复制),如使用同步复制,需考虑带宽及延时对存储读写性能的影响,如使用异步复制,则需考虑可能...显示全部

构建跨多站点的分布式存储集群时建议考虑: 各站点之间是否部署同1个集群,如果为同1个集群需重点关注网络带宽和时延是否可满足集群需要;如果为不同集群,需考虑数据同步方式(同步复制或异步复制),如使用同步复制,需考虑带宽及延时对存储读写性能的影响,如使用异步复制,则需考虑可能存在的数据传输时延引起的数据丢失恢复方案以及业务对该场景的容忍度。

收起
互联网服务 · 2020-01-16
浏览2136
adamshaoadamshao软件架构设计师XSKY星辰天合
一般多站点是为了解决数据可靠性问题,需要解决应用对RPO和RTO的要求。对于同城双活的需求,可以使用单个延伸集群的方案,可以达到RPO=0, RTO~0,站点之间物理距离100km以内,网络延时5ms以内,带宽要求10Gb以上;对于异步复制的多站点,RPO分钟级,RTO小时级的需求,则一般对物理距离没有...显示全部

一般多站点是为了解决数据可靠性问题,需要解决应用对RPO和RTO的要求。对于同城双活的需求,可以使用单个延伸集群的方案,可以达到RPO=0, RTO~0,站点之间物理距离100km以内,网络延时5ms以内,带宽要求10Gb以上;对于异步复制的多站点,RPO分钟级,RTO小时级的需求,则一般对物理距离没有要求。

收起
软件开发 · 2020-03-10
浏览1803

问题来自

相关问题

相关资料

相关文章

问题状态

  • 发布时间:2020-01-06
  • 关注会员:3 人
  • 问题浏览:3367
  • 最近回答:2020-03-10
  • X社区推广